Assign a role to students during import
This commit is contained in:
parent
0bcdcf9941
commit
695f6a016c
|
|
@ -40,6 +40,10 @@ class Command(BaseCommand):
|
||||||
self.stdout.write("Assigning teacher role")
|
self.stdout.write("Assigning teacher role")
|
||||||
teacher = Role.objects.get(key='teacher')
|
teacher = Role.objects.get(key='teacher')
|
||||||
UserRole.objects.get_or_create(user=user, role=teacher)
|
UserRole.objects.get_or_create(user=user, role=teacher)
|
||||||
|
else:
|
||||||
|
self.stdout.write("Assigning student role")
|
||||||
|
student = Role.objects.get(key='teacher')
|
||||||
|
UserRole.objects.get_or_create(user=user, role=student)
|
||||||
|
|
||||||
self.stdout.write("Adding to class(es) {}".format(', '.join(school_class_names)))
|
self.stdout.write("Adding to class(es) {}".format(', '.join(school_class_names)))
|
||||||
for school_class_name in school_class_names:
|
for school_class_name in school_class_names:
|
||||||
|
|
|
||||||
Loading…
Reference in New Issue